Merge branch 'core-urgent-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/tip

Pull address-limit checking fixes from Ingo Molnar:
 "This fixes a number of bugs in the address-limit (USER_DS) checks that
  got introduced in the merge window, (mostly) affecting the ARM and
  ARM64 platforms"

* 'core-urgent-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/tip:
  arm64/syscalls: Move address limit check in loop
  arm/syscalls: Optimize address limit check
  Revert "arm/syscalls: Check address limit on user-mode return"
  syscalls: Use CHECK_DATA_CORRUPTION for addr_limit_user_check
